Hockey

We had a great day at the hockey today.  It was super super hot and sunny.  We even got a little sunburnt!  Whoops!  We watched the semi final match between the Australian's and German's. It's great to see that even top level hockey players argue with the ref!  Using the video ref a German goal was removed from the scoreboard! Olympic Park was once again absolutely packed and it took us 50 mins to walk from the Riverbank Arena to Stratford Train Station just due to the shear number of spectators in Olympic Park.  If you happen to be watching we should be easy to spot as we were directly opposite the cameras, right at the top of the stands under the black umbrella.
BTW Germany won 4-2
